Input: atkbd - fix HANGEUL/HANJA keys

Make atkbd report HANGEUL/HANJA keys by default and use correct scan
codes for these keys (they were swapped). Also make sure their scancodes
reported as EV_MSC/MSC_SCAN events.

Signed-off-by: Dmitry Torokhov <dtor@mail.ru>
diff --git a/drivers/char/keyboard.c b/drivers/char/keyboard.c
index d82368b..6cb85dc 100644
--- a/drivers/char/keyboard.c
+++ b/drivers/char/keyboard.c
@@ -1075,10 +1075,12 @@
 			put_queue(vc, 0x45 | up_flag);
 			return 0;
 		case KEY_HANGEUL:
-			if (!up_flag) put_queue(vc, 0xf1);
+			if (!up_flag)
+				put_queue(vc, 0xf2);
 			return 0;
 		case KEY_HANJA:
-			if (!up_flag) put_queue(vc, 0xf2);
+			if (!up_flag)
+				put_queue(vc, 0xf1);
 			return 0;
 	}